AI工具助力需求规格说明书编写:5步实操指南

第一步:需求收集与整理

AI能做什么

  1. 自动提取需求:从会议记录、用户反馈中识别关键需求点。
  2. 分类与排序:按优先级(高/中/低)和类型(功能/非功能)自动归类。

操作步骤

  1. 上传资料:将原始资料(如微信聊天记录、邮件、会议录音转文字)导入AI工具(如DeepSeek、ChatGPT)。
  2. 指令示例



  1. 请从以下内容中提取需求,按优先级排序: [粘贴用户反馈或会议记录]
  2. 输出结果
  3. 高优先级:登录页面加载时间≤2秒
  4. 中优先级:新增短信验证码登录
  5. 低优先级:支持指纹识别

第二步:需求分析与细化

AI能做什么

  1. 生成用户故事:将模糊需求转化为标准格式(如“作为用户,我希望...”)。
  2. 拆解子任务:将大需求分解为具体开发任务。

操作步骤

  1. 输入需求


2.AI指令

  1. 输出结果
  2. 用户故事
    “作为用户,我希望通过短信验证码登录,以便快速进入系统。”
  3. 子任务
    1. 后端:设计验证码发送接口
    2. 前端:开发验证码输入框
    3. 测试:验证码有效期测试

第三步:需求文档编写

AI能做什么

  1. 生成文档框架:自动创建目录和章节结构。
  2. 填充内容:根据需求点生成详细描述。

操作步骤

  1. 生成框架
  2. 输入指令:请生成《用户登录优化需求文档》的目录框架。

输出结果:

1. 项目背景  
2. 功能需求  
  2.1 登录性能优化  
  2.2 短信验证码登录  
3. 非功能需求  
  3.1 性能要求  
  3.2 安全要求  
  1. 填充内容
  2. 输入指令:
请详细描述“登录页面性能优化”需求,包括技术方案。  
  1. 请详细描述“登录页面性能优化”需求,包括技术方案。
  2. 输出结果:
需求描述:  
- 页面加载时间≤2秒  
- 技术方案:  
  1. 使用CDN加速静态资源  
  2. 图片懒加载  
  3. 减少首屏HTTP请求数量  
  1. 需求描述: - 页面加载时间≤2秒 - 技术方案: 1. 使用CDN加速静态资源 2. 图片懒加载 3. 减少首屏HTTP请求数量

第四步:需求验证与补充

AI能做什么

  1. 生成测试用例:自动创建功能验证场景。
  2. 检查漏洞:发现需求矛盾或遗漏点。

操作步骤

  1. 生成测试用例
  2. 输入指令:
请为“短信验证码登录”生成3个测试用例。  

输出结果:

用例1:输入正确手机号 → 收到6位验证码  
用例2:输入错误手机号 → 提示“手机号无效”  
用例3:验证码超时 → 提示“验证码已过期”  

检查漏洞

  • 输入指令:

检查以下需求是否完整: “用户登录需支持短信验证码”

输出指令:

缺失需求:  
- 验证码有效期(建议60秒)  
- 每日发送次数限制(建议≤5次) 

第五步:文档维护与协作

AI能做什么

  1. 自动更新文档:根据需求变更修改内容。
  2. 生成变更记录:记录版本更新说明。

操作步骤

  1. 更新文档
  2. 输入指令:
需求变更:新增“指纹登录”功能,请更新文档。  

输出结果:

新增章节:2.3 指纹登录  
- 需求描述:支持iOS/Android指纹识别登录  
- 技术要求:调用原生生物识别API  

生成变更记录

  • 输入指令:
生成版本v1.1的变更说明。 

输出结果:

v1.1更新:  
- 新增指纹登录需求  
- 补充验证码发送次数限制  

实际案例:登录功能优化项目

背景:某APP用户反馈登录流程复杂,加载慢。
AI使用效果

  1. 效率提升:文档编写时间从3天缩短到1天。
  2. 质量提升:AI发现3处需求遗漏,减少开发返工。
  3. 团队协作:自动生成的任务列表直接导入Jira,分配责任人。

常用工具推荐

  1. 需求分析:DeepSeek、ChatGPT
  2. 文档管理:Notion AI、Confluence(AI插件)
  3. 任务跟踪:Jira(AI助手)、ClickUp

总结
使用AI工具编写需求规格说明书,就像拥有一个“智能助手”:

  • 收集需求 → AI整理杂乱信息
  • 分析需求 → AI生成用户故事和任务
  • 编写文档 → AI输出标准框架和内容
  • 验证维护 → AI查漏补缺、自动更新

即使零基础,只要会输入指令,就能快速完成专业文档!

原文链接:,转发请注明来源!